  • In this activity, students test nitrate levels in various samples of water and draw possible informed conclusions about the results.

    By the end of this activity, students should be able to:

    • explain why excessive nitrate can be harmful
    • demonstrate how to test water for nitrate
    • make an informed decision about safe nitrate levels in drinking water.
